Odpowiedz 
 
Ocena wątku:
  • 4 Głosów - 5 Średnio
  • 1
  • 2
  • 3
  • 4
  • 5
Sterownik przemiennika
SQ8MVY Offline
Paweł
****

Liczba postów: 724
Dołączył: 30-07-2011
Post: #101
RE: Sterownik przemiennika
Witam,

Napisz, co chcesz osiągnąć poprzez ustawienie fusebitów. W PonyProg ustawiasz fusbity w Command -> Security and Configuration bit
Z poziomu programatora w Bascom rówież ustawisz fusbity.
Dla zewnętrznego kwarca od 3 do 8MHz bez dzielnika /8, ustawiasz fusbity na:
Low: FD
High: DF
Extended: FF

Warto również zmienić tego PonyProga na coś nowszego, szybszego, mniej problematycznego obsługującego dużo większą paletę AVR-ków

73 Paweł
(Ten post był ostatnio modyfikowany: 08-10-2020 20:05 przez SQ8MVY.)
08-10-2020 20:05
Znajdź wszystkie posty użytkownika Odpowiedz cytując ten post
SP7QHP Offline
Nowicjusz
*

Liczba postów: 18
Dołączył: 20-09-2017
Post: #102
RE: Sterownik przemiennika
mam stk200 kupionego kiedyś tam ( z 10lat temu) , na bascom avr nie byłem w stanie zaprogramować , na ponyprog bez problemu , dlaczego się pytam , bo procek chodzi na wew. generatorze , ton jest około 400-600hz , znamiennik nadawany w tempie 5 grup na min. podtrzymanie tx ok. 2min i przypuszczam że podczas kompilacji bascom zrobił babola i nie zapisał fuse bitów lub żle to zrobił , a dla mnie to czarna magia , uczę się na błędach i dlatego się pytam jak je ustawić , aby działało prawidłowo , jest to pierwsze moje programowanie , dla nie których zadaje dziecinne pytania .
08-10-2020 20:59
Znajdź wszystkie posty użytkownika Odpowiedz cytując ten post
SQ8MVY Offline
Paweł
****

Liczba postów: 724
Dołączył: 30-07-2011
Post: #103
RE: Sterownik przemiennika
Ok,

W BascomAVR ustawiać fusbity można z poziomu kodu programu za pomocą dyrektywy $PROG. Opisane jest to w manualu do Bascoma ,na stronie producenta.

Jeżeli posiadasz STK500, to użyj najpopularniejszego programu obsługujący programatory do AVR - avrdude. Na ten program dostępne są również nakładki graficzne, które ułatwią Ci posługiwanie się nim - avrdudess, avrdude-gui, mkAvrCalculator.

Wartości fusebitów dla ATtiny2313, kwarc 4MHz, wyłączony dzielnik taktowania /8, podałem w poprzednim poście.

İmage

73 Paweł
(Ten post był ostatnio modyfikowany: 09-10-2020 10:17 przez SQ8MVY.)
08-10-2020 21:31
Znajdź wszystkie posty użytkownika Odpowiedz cytując ten post
SP7QHP Offline
Nowicjusz
*

Liczba postów: 18
Dołączył: 20-09-2017
Post: #104
RE: Sterownik przemiennika
dzięki za pomoc , skompilowałem program jeszcze raz , sprawdziłem ustawienie fuse bitów z notą katalogową i z tym co kolega podał , zaprogramowałem procek przy pomocy ponyprog i też w nim sprawdziłem fuse bity , sterownik działa prawidłowo , teraz czas na zmontowanie wszystkiego w całość i zawiezienie przemiennika w docelowe miejsce , zdjęcie https://www.fotosik.pl/zdjecie/b2b362f3ed3ab795 , przemiennik działa
mam jeszcze jedno pytanie czy można zrobić tak aby wentylator działał jeszcze z 30sekund po wyłączeniu nadajnika z poziomu sterownika ,jak to ma być duży kłopot to zrobię zwykłą czasówkę na 555 , pozdrawiam
(Ten post był ostatnio modyfikowany: 10-10-2020 20:53 przez SP7QHP.)
09-10-2020 18:43
Znajdź wszystkie posty użytkownika Odpowiedz cytując ten post
Odpowiedz 


Skocz do:


Użytkownicy przeglądający ten wątek: 6 gości